Testing the Difference Between Two Proportions In Exercises 712, (a) identify the claim and state H0 and Ha, (b) find the critical value(s) and identify the rejection region(s), (c) find the standardized test statistic z, (d) decide whether to reject or fail to reject the null hypothesis, and (e) interpret the decision in the context of the original claim. Assume the samples are random and independent. If convenient, use technology.Plantar Heel Pain In a 4-week study about the effectiveness of usingmagnetic insoles to treat plantar heel pain, 54 subjects wore magneticinsoles and 41 subjects wore nonmagnetic insoles. The results are shown atthe left. At a = 0.01, can you support the claim that there is a differencein the proportion of subjects who feel all or mostly better between the twogroups? (Adapted from The Journal of the American Medical Association)
